AZ31B镁合金板液压-机械拉深试验研究

摘    要:对AZ31B镁合金板进行液压-机械拉深试验,分析其变形特点和液压力对其成形性能的影响规律,并对液压拉深件的破裂现象进行了分析.试验结果表明,AZ31B镁合金板在液压-机械拉深时的成形性能比普通拉深时的差,主要原因是AZ31B镁合金板本身的塑性变形能力差,液压力未能及时发挥作用.

Deformation behaviors of AZ31B magnesium alloy sheets in hydromechanical deep drawing

Abstract:The experimental research on the hydromechanical deep drawing of AZ31B magnesium alloy sheets was conducted.The deformation behaviors and the influence of hydraulic pressure on its formability were investigated,and the fracture behavior of the obtained workpieces was discussed.The experimental results show that the formability of AZ31B magnesium alloy sheets in hydromechanical deep drawing is poorer than that in mechanical deep drawing at room temperature because the hydraulic pressure fails to work effecti...
